Agadir Car Rental
Posted: Fri May 15, 2009 02:58 PM UTC
Hello,
i am leaving to Agadir within 3 weeks.
Who can help me out?!

Could anyone tell what is the best option for rent a car?
Shall i do it in advance on the internet? its about 220 euors for 1 week.
Or shall i rent a car in Agadir, is that less expensive?
Can i also rent a scooter there?

What are also the best places i should have seen in my holiday?

Thanks!

Hi, there are a number of pages on Agadir put together by VTers to give you ideas of what to see and do - I have a page myself for example - click on Trvel guide and you will be taken to lists of pages such as Top 5 and so on, or newest pages.

I have rented a car many times in Morocco - and usually do it when I get there - though generally Ive got help of locals to get more a local price rather than a tourist price but I have connections where I can rent my own directly for okay prices but not done so in Agadir - though my connections had once when in Agadir found that prices there were much cheaper than Marrakech. about £20-25 a day is about the cheapest Ive been able to get in Marrakech.

Just make sure the insurance is okay and youre happy with whatever theyve got in place for excess etc. otherwise it is alot cheaper but try and haggle too - dont make it sound like its your first visit to Morocco! I have also found recently that with the international companies for example now based at the Marrakech airport Ive been able to haggle their prices and end up with fairly reasonable prices.

so if you are flying into Agadir try whats on offer at the airport but haggle. otherwise the price you have for 220 euros if it includes insurance is quite a good price so if you are happy with that then book it.

There are some lovely places to drive from Agadir which Ive got in my page there - particularly the drive up the coast to Essaouira with some fishing villages such as Imsouane on the way, and the drive to Tafroute down over Col Kerdous to Tiznit and Aglou Plage and back up to Agadir is a must!

a drive out to Immouzzer is nice

and a visit to the Souss Massa national park is very good - park your car there - the guides at the gate are good value to maximise your time - and have a walk around the national park, beside the river and to the views to the sea.

a day tripto Tarouddant and its souk and round the walls is quite good.

If you will only be in Agadir for 1 week you might not need a car for the city as taxi's are easy to flag down and cost very little. You will find car rental firms around most hotels and with tourism not doing very well you should be able to negotiate a good price for 5 days. A small car should cost no more than 300Dh(£25)per day. Don't forget to take your driving license and keep your documents with you at all times.. Keep to the speed limit, Radar traps are in the most isolated places and you can get an on the spot fine if you are snared.
